Maintenance Development Engineer

Vanderlande is the market leader in efficient logistics process automation within the airports and parcel sector. In addition, we are a leading supplier of process automation solutions for warehouses.

Vanderlande has a strong strategic partnership with Heathrow Airport. Heathrow, with more than 80 million passengers a year, is the most active airport in Europe with the highest number of connections to other airports. All these passengers expect their luggage to reach the same destination. That’s where Vanderlande comes in as a strategic partner, with full responsibility for the performance and maintenance of Heathrow’s baggage handling systems.

Your role

Working within London Heathrow Airport, the Maintenance Development Engineer is responsible for ensuring the effectiveness of maintenance plans and asset performance across the operation.

You will translate maintenance concepts into practical, executable plans and standard procedures, analyse system performance, and drive continuous improvement initiatives across the site. You will be performing the following tasks

Translate maintenance concepts into effective and executable maintenance plans Develop, implement, and manage maintenance plans within the Maximo CMMS, including asset structures, inventory, and reporting Ensure installed asset data is accurate, complete, and maintained within the system Analyse maintenance and equipment performance data to optimise reliability and availability Identify root causes of recurring issues and implement permanent corrective actions Initiate and lead continuous improvement (CI) projects to enhance system performance Develop and implement standard operating procedures (SOPs) and train operational teams Support maintenance planners and technicians in executing maintenance strategies Provide technical input to lifecycle planning and major maintenance activities Conduct maintainability assessments for new or modified systems

What We Expect From You

As a Maintenance Development Engineer, you will play a key role in driving performance, reliability, and continuous improvement within a fast-paced automated environment. We expect the following of you

Qualified to HNC/HND or higher in a relevant Engineering discipline Strong maintenance engineering and technical background Knowledge of industrial automation systems and components Experience using CMMS tools (preferably IBM Maximo) Understanding of reliability methodologies such as RCM and FMECA Ability to analyse data to improve MTBF and MTTR performance Familiarity with predictive and condition-based maintenance techniques Experience in continuous improvement practices Strong communication skills, with the ability to convey technical concepts to non-technical stakeholders Ability to work collaboratively and influence across multiple levels Strong problem-solving skills with the ability to prioritise key issues
